The Discreet Charm of the Bourgeoisie
The Discreet Charm of the Bourgeoisie
Watch TrailerWatch Movie
Share
The Discreet Charm of the Bourgeoisie
1972
1h 41m
7.5(854 votes)
Comedy

Overview

In Luis Buñuel’s deliciously satiric masterpiece, an upper-class sextet sits down to dinner but never eats, their attempts continually thwarted by a vaudevillian mixture of events both actual and imagined.
